Interest Rate Differential
The difference in interest rates between two financial instruments or two countries, often influencing currency values and investment flows.
Forward Exchange Rate
The agreed-upon exchange rate for currencies to be exchanged on a specified future date.
Swaps
Financial derivatives contracts where two parties agree to exchange one stream of cash flows for another, often used to manage risk or speculate.
Securities
Financial instruments that represent an ownership position in a publicly-traded corporation (stock), a creditor relationship with a governmental body or a corporation (bond), or rights to ownership as represented by an option.
